A 31-year-old “emotionally disturbed man” was shot and killed by police early Sunday in Boston’s South End.

A woman called 911 from her Shawmut Avenue apartment to say her son was out of control. Both police and Boston EMS responded, WCVB reported.

After police arrived, a struggle ensued and the man pulled out a knife. The man allegedly swung repeatedly at officers and EMTs, and they were unable to get the knife away, police said.

Officer fired their weapons, killing the man, whose identity wasn’t disclosed by investigators.

“Unfortunately it turned ugly,” Boston police Commissioner William Evans said to reporters after the shooting. “The officers intervened. They tried to disarm, and unfortunately, he just kept coming at the officers and it left them no choice right now.”

Several EMTs and police officers are being treated for head and back injuries suffered during the struggle.
